Work begins on 拢155m South Lanarkshire wind farm set to power 45,000 homes

By Andrea Lambrou

Work begins on 拢155m South Lanarkshire wind farm set to power 45,000 homes

The 33.4 MW onshore wind project will feature some of the UK鈥檚 most advanced turbines, harnessing cutting-edge technology to maximise energy generation and efficiency.

Read More…